Answer to Question 1

The nutritional risks in pregnancy include age 15 or under; unwanted pregnancy; many pregnancies close together; history of poor pregnancy outcome; poverty; lack of access to health care; low education level; inadequate diet; iron-deficiency anemia early in pregnancy; cigarette smoking; alcohol or other substance abuse; chronic disease requiring a special diet; underweight or overweight; insufficient or excessive weight gain; and carrying twins or triplets.

Bisphosphonates were first developed in the nineteenth century. They were first investigated for use in disorders of bone metabolism in the 1960s. They are now used clinically for the treatment of osteoporosis, Paget's disease, bone metastasis, multiple myeloma, and other conditions that feature bone fragility.
